Researchers Highlight Advances in Cancer Detection

Leading medical researchers, doctors, and innovators convened at the NXT Conclave 2026 in New Delhi to discuss transformative technologies improving cancer care. The panel detailed breakthroughs in AI-based thermal screening for breast cancer, targeted drug delivery via injectable hydrogels, and advanced immunotherapies. Experts emphasized that these innovations aim to overcome barriers of cost and accessibility, significantly boost early detection rates, and improve survival outcomes for patients globally.

Key Takeaways:

  • AI Thermal Screening: Portable, radiation-free AI system screens for breast cancer at one-tenth the cost of mammograms, already used for nearly 500,000 women.
  • High Survival with Early Detection: Survival rates can exceed 90% when cancer is detected in its earliest stages, though screening rates remain critically low.
  • Targeted Drug Delivery: Experimental injectable hydrogel technology localized chemotherapy, reducing tumor size by 75% in 18 days during studies.
  • Immunotherapy Advances: Research into CAR-T cell therapy and biomaterial implants is training the immune system to better recognize and attack cancer cells.

AI-Powered Screening Aims to Democratize Early Detection

A key discussion focused on overcoming the stark reality that only about 1.3% of women in India undergo mammography. Experts presented an AI-powered thermal imaging technology designed to address four key barriers: affordability, accessibility, accuracy, and acceptability. This portable system uses infrared imaging and machine learning to detect tumors, enabling low-cost screening even in remote regions and aiming to curb the nearly 276 daily breast cancer deaths in India.

Targeted Therapies Minimize Treatment Side Effects

Researchers showcased innovations that deliver treatment directly to tumors, sparing healthy tissue. A scientist from IIT Guwahati described an injectable hydrogel that releases chemotherapy drugs locally, potentially reducing common systemic side effects. Separately, panelists discussed progress in immunotherapy, including the exploration of biomaterial implants to stimulate immune responses against solid tumors, building on the success of CAR-T therapies for blood cancers.

Early Detection Remains Critical for Improving Outcomes

Experts unanimously stressed that timely diagnosis is paramount, citing cancers like pancreatic cancer that often present with late-stage symptoms. Research into predictive tools, such as analyzing exosomes released by cancer cells to forecast therapy resistance, was highlighted as a frontier for personalizing care. The session framed these technological leaps as essential tools for shifting cancer from a often fatal diagnosis to a more manageable condition.
